Overview
Omega-3 fatty acids, specifically e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A), are long-chain polyunsaturated fatty acids primarily derived from the tissues of oily fish such as salmon, mackerel, and sardines. Benefits
Omega-3 fatty acids offer several evidence-based benefits. For cardiovascular health, meta-analyses indicate that fish oil supplementation can reduce risk factors such as ventricular arrhythmias (ventricular tachycardia and fibrillation) and significantly improve lipid profiles, particularly by reducing triglycerides (p < 0.05). In the context of metabolic dysfunction, a 2025 systematic review and meta-analysis of RCTs found that fish oil supplementation improved markers associated with metabolic-associated steatotic liver disease (MASLD), showing statistically significant improvements in liver enzymes and lipid profiles. Cognitive function also benefits, with a dose-response meta-analysis suggesting that omega-3 supplementation improves cognitive function in both healthy individuals and those with mild cognitive impairment or dementia, with effect sizes increasing with doses up to approximately 2000 mg/day. Secondary benefits include antioxidant support from components like tocotrienols and astaxanthin, which may offer additional cardiovascular and immune advantages. These benefits are particularly relevant for individuals with cardiovascular risk, metabolic disorders, and cognitive decline. Effect sizes for cognitive and metabolic outcomes typically range from small to moderate (0.2 to 0.5 SMD), with relative risk reductions for cardiac arrhythmias reported between 20-30%. Benefits usually manifest after several weeks to months of consistent supplementation.
How it works
Omega-3 fatty acids exert their effects through several primary biological pathways. They modulate inflammatory responses by influencing the production of eicosanoids, reduce triglyceride synthesis in the liver, and improve endothelial function, which is crucial for blood vessel health. DHA, in particular, is a critical structural component of neuronal membranes, contributing to their fluidity and overall function, which supports cognitive processes. These fatty acids interact with various body systems, including the cardiovascular system by stabilizing heart rhythm and improving lipid metabolism, the central nervous system by enhancing cognitive function, the liver by promoting fatty acid oxidation, and the immune system through their anti-inflammatory properties. Known molecular targets include peroxisome proliferator-activated receptors (PPARs), cyclooxygenase enzymes (COX), and ion channels in cardiac myocytes. Fish oil is absorbed in the small intestine, with bioavailability influenced by factors such as the specific formulation (triglyceride vs. ethyl ester forms), concurrent intake of dietary fats, and overall digestive health.
Side effects
Fish oil supplements are generally considered safe and well-tolerated when taken at recommended doses. The most common side effects, affecting more than 5% of users, are mild gastrointestinal symptoms such as a fishy aftertaste, burping, and mild nausea. Less common side effects, occurring in 1-5% of individuals, include diarrhea, bloating, and allergic reactions, particularly in those with fish allergies. Rare side effects, observed in less than 1% of users, primarily involve an increased risk of bleeding, especially at very high doses exceeding 3 grams per day. This bleeding risk necessitates caution in patients with pre-existing bleeding disorders or those concurrently taking anticoagulant medications (blood thinners) like warfarin, as fish oil can potentiate their effects. Therefore, individuals on such medications should consult a healthcare provider before starting supplementation. Dosage
For general health benefits, a minimum effective dose of 500 mg to 1000 mg of combined EPA and DHA daily is often recommended for cardiovascular and cognitive support. Optimal dosage ranges commonly observed in clinical trials demonstrating efficacy are between 1000 mg and 3000 mg of EPA+DHA per day. The maximum safe dose for fish oil is generally considered to be up to 3000 mg/day; doses higher than this should only be taken under medical supervision due to an increased risk of bleeding. To enhance absorption and minimize gastrointestinal discomfort, fish oil supplements are often best taken with meals, as co-ingestion with dietary fat significantly improves bioavailability. The triglyceride form of fish oil is generally preferred over the ethyl ester form due to its superior absorption. Can Kyäni Fish Oil Blend replace prescription omega-3 medications?
While beneficial, it may complement but generally should not replace prescription omega-3 formulations, especially for severe conditions like hypertriglyceridemia, without medical advice.
Does Kyäni Fish Oil Blend help with brain health?
Yes, evidence supports that omega-3s, particularly DHA, contribute to improved cognitive function and brain health, especially in aging populations and those with mild impairment.
